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7940 517381197 290183 76004134931
13 9469
13 9469
86279 368624903 666
All about undefined
Interested in learning more?
13 9469
86279 368624903 666
See more
249 03940
871 043914 6442 17
See more
2769414760 0045201227
18699998833 29 86251170 71657977017 239
See more